Top Local Places

Harrow Leisure Centre Swimming Pool

, London, United Kingdom
Local business

Description

ad


Quiz

NEAR Harrow Leisure Centre Swimming Pool

Sheppards Pie Cakes

London, United Kingdom
Event planning/event services